    Default Expanded Movement

    Hi guys, I decided to bring my own contribution to this great mod!
    As I could see the movement is pretty limited and it can take you a lot to reach a settlement. Game will take place faster so you'll have more action and less debt to catch.
    Here is the file you need ,I added 100 movement points for all kind of agents and armies, except the unused ones.
    descr_character.txt

    Default Re: Expanded Movement

    No, changes in movement points are save-game compatible, just that sometimes they can have effect starting from next turn.

    BTW I don't know if you're aware, but in this mod armies (on the field and not in settlement) led by a general at the start of the turn have more movement compared to armies led by captains. In your file they are 260, respectively 240, IIRC. In vanilla the numbers are equal (80 I think). Interesting actually, this way armies led by generals no matter how bad will march a bit more than armies led by captains, making generals more important.
